Teaching Experience
BS162: Organismal and Population Biology
Teaching Assistant (2 semesters)
This course aims to provide undergraduate students with introductory knowledge on the topics of biological diversity, organismal biology, principles of evolution, transmission genetics, population biology, community structure, and ecology.
BS172: Organismal and Population Biology Laboratory
Teaching Assistant (1 semester)
This lab course aims to teach undergrad students basic knowledge and skills in organismal biology and research methods. Students learn about experimental design, statistical methods, and hypothesis testing through original research projects and guided activities related to genetics, ecology, and evolution.
